Abstract

The invention discloses garbage bin surface cleaning equipment which comprises a driving module, a cleaning module, a protection module and a garbage bin, wherein the driving module comprises a fixed column, a moving bottom plate, a moving wheel, a top end fixing plate, a lifting motor sleeve support, a lifting motor sleeve, a lifting motor, a lifting nut limiting plate, a lifting nut, a lifting screw rod, an anti-rotation rod, a connecting plate, a driving motor sleeve, a ring gear, a driving frame, a driven gear limiting plate support, a stabilizing column, a ring gear connecting column and a lifting driving gear. According to the garbage can, the cleaning module is arranged, so that the outer surface of the garbage can be cleaned in all directions, the problem that manual cleaning wastes time and labor is solved, and the protection module is arranged, so that when the water pressure in the water storage shell is too high, the pressure in the water storage shell can be slightly released through the vertical movement of the telescopic piston, and the safety of the garbage can in use is improved.

When the garbage can is used, a user firstly moves the garbage can to the vicinity of the garbage can 4, the user firstly opens the water storage shells 201, then closes the two water storage shells 201 on the outer side of the garbage can 4, at this time, the lifting motor 107 is started, the lifting motor 107 enables the lifting nut 109 to rotate through the lifting driving gear 123, the lifting nut 109 rotates to drive the lifting screw 110 to vertically move, the lifting screw 110 vertically moves to enable the driving frame 117 to vertically move through the stabilizing column 121, the driving frame 117 enables the gear of the ring gear 115 to be meshed with the gear of the input gear 210 through the ring gear connecting column 122, at this time, the driving motor 113 is started to enable the driving gear 116 to rotate, the driving gear 116 drives the driven gear 118 to rotate, because the driven gear 118 is fixedly connected with the driving frame 117, the driving frame 117 also rotates, the driving frame 117 rotates to drive the ring gear 115 to rotate, at this time, the input gear 210 rotates under the driving of, the rotation of the input gear 210 rotates the other driven pulleys 212 together through the transmission belt 214, and since the brush rotation plate 208 and the driven pulley 212 are fixedly connected through the water transfer rotation tube 211, all the brush rotation plates 208 are rotated, and at this time, the inside of the water storage case 201 is flushed, and the water flows into the brush 209 through the water transfer rotation tube 211, and this water is mixed together when the brush 209 rubs against the outer surface of the tub 4, thereby enhancing the cleaning effect when the surface of the tub 4 is cleaned.
